LAGRANGE COUNTY, IN (WTVB) – The body of a 16-year-old boy was recovered from Witmer Lake in LaGrange County on Sunday evening following an intensive search and rescue operation.
Emergency personnel responded to the scene at 5:01 p.m. after reports that a teenager had jumped from a boat without a life jacket on the southeast side of the lake and failed to resurface. The LaGrange County Sheriff’s Department immediately instructed boaters to clear the water to assist first responders.
Despite the rapid joint response from local fire crews, the Indiana State Police, and DNR Law Enforcement, the operation shifted into a recovery mission by 7:30 p.m.
The LaGrange County Coroner’s Office has taken over the investigation into what is currently being treated as an apparent drowning.
Officials have withheld the identity of the victim pending notification of the family. While initial reports detail the accidental nature of the jump near Wolcottville, an autopsy and subsequent toxicology analysis will formally establish the final cause and manner of death.
